In-Depth Analysis

How they compare in practice

When comparing the PETKIT Purobot Crystal Duo and the WARCAT Self Cleaning Litter Box Automatic, the most significant practical difference lies in their waste management and value proposition. The WARCAT boasts a generous 10-liter waste drawer capacity, almost double the PETKIT's 5.5 liters. In real-world usage, this translates to significantly less frequent emptying, potentially extending the time between clean-outs to over a week for a single cat, offering considerable convenience for busy pet owners. The PETKIT, while effective, will require more regular attention to its smaller waste bin.

Safety is another critical point of divergence. The WARCAT employs a detailed multi-sensor system, including infrared, Hall effect, and microwave radar sensors, offering a comprehensive approach to detecting pet presence and ensuring safe operation during cleaning cycles. While PETKIT features 'OmniSense' sensors, WARCAT's explicit enumeration of its multiple sensor types instills greater confidence in its safety protocols.

For pet health tracking, the PETKIT distinguishes itself with an AI camera and urinary health monitor, providing advanced insights that go beyond basic usage statistics. This feature caters to owners who are keen on proactive health management. The WARCAT's app also tracks toilet habits, but without the explicit 'urinary health monitor' designation. The WARCAT, however, introduces additional odor control with an airtight cover and fragrant gel, a practical benefit for maintaining a fresh home environment, though the gel requires periodic replacement. Considering the WARCAT's lower price of $175.99 compared to PETKIT's $199.99, coupled with its larger waste capacity and robust safety features, it offers a more compelling value for most users, while PETKIT appeals to a niche focused on advanced health diagnostics.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about this comparison

What is the primary difference in waste capacity?

The WARCAT has a 10-liter waste drawer, allowing for longer intervals between emptying. The PETKIT has a 5.5-liter waste drawer, which will require more frequent disposal of waste.

Do these litter boxes require a subscription for app features?

No, both the PETKIT Purobot Crystal Duo and the WARCAT Self Cleaning Litter Box Automatic state an app subscription cost of $0, meaning their smart features are accessible without ongoing fees.

Which litter box is safer for my cat?

The WARCAT explicitly lists a multi-sensor system (infrared, Hall effect, microwave radar) designed for comprehensive pet safety during operation. PETKIT uses 'OmniSense' sensors, also for safety.

Can these devices accommodate larger cats?

Yes, both are suitable for larger felines. The PETKIT can handle cats up to 25.0 lbs, while the WARCAT supports cats weighing up to 24.2 lbs, a negligible difference for most users.

How do these products manage odor?

The WARCAT features an airtight cover and utilizes fragrant gel to reduce litter odor. The PETKIT incorporates odor control, though specific mechanisms beyond auto-cleaning are not detailed.
